YOKOGAWA RB401 S4 Remote I/O Modules
The Yokogawa RB401 S4 , also cataloged as the RB401 RIO Bus Module, operates as a dedicated hardware component for remote I/O communication and signal routing within CENTUM VP platforms.
Hardware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model | RB401 S4 |
| Brand | Yokogawa |
| Origin | Japan |
| Weight | 0.3 kg (0 lbs 9.0 oz) |
| Dimensions | 2.5 cm x 25.4 cm x 20.3 cm (1.0 in x 10.0 in x 8.0 in) |
| Operating Temp | -20 to 60 deg C |
| Power Consumption | 24 VDC input voltage |
| Communication Interface | Modbus TCP/IP |
| Analog Inputs | 16 channels |
| Digital Inputs | 8 channels |
| Analog Outputs | 8 channels |
| Digital Outputs | 4 channels |
| Mounting Type | Rack mount |
Channel-to-Channel Isolation & Fieldbus Data Routing
The RB401 S4 provides deterministic communication bridging between remote field stations and central processing units via Modbus TCP/IP protocols over Ethernet. Integrated channel-to-channel isolation on analog and digital I/O lines prevents cross-channel noise propagation and ground loop potential differences. Onboard signal processing paths maintain low transmission latencies and preserve 4-20 mA HART signal integrity across distributed control networks.

Field Installation Guidelines
- Mount the RB401 S4 module securely into the designated rack slot, ensuring retaining screws are tightened to maintain structural integrity under vibration.
- Ensure ambient cabinet temperature is maintained within the operating range of -20 to 60 deg C.
- Wire power connections using 24 VDC supply lines with verified polarity before energizing the module.
- Terminate Modbus TCP/IP industrial Ethernet cables with shielded RJ45 connectors and route network cables away from high-voltage field wiring to prevent signal noise.
- Connect all field signal cable shields to the main cabinet ground bus to preserve channel-to-channel galvanic isolation performance.
